Description
What You'll Do:
-
Infrastructure as Code: Design, build, and maintain our cloud infrastructure (AWS or equivalent) using infrastructure-as-code tools (e.g., Terraform, CloudFormation, Pulumi) to keep environments reproducible, auditable, and scalable.
-
CI/CD Pipelines: Build and maintain CI/CD pipelines that support fast, reliable, and safe deployments across the platform's frontend, backend, and ML orchestration services.
-
Observability & Monitoring: Implement and maintain monitoring, logging, and alerting (Grafana) to give the team real-time visibility into system health and quickly surface issues before they impact customers.
-
Reliability & Incident Response: Drive reliability engineering practices. Uptime targets, SLOs/SLAs, incident response processes, on-call rotations, and driving accountability for PIRs. Our clients demand high availability for time-sensitive deal and scientific data.
-
Security & Compliance: Implement and enforce best practices for secure infrastructure, including network security, secrets management, access controls, and data protection.
-
Cost & Performance Optimization: Monitor and optimize cloud spend and system performance, balancing cost efficiency with the reliability and scalability the platform requires. You should know an AWS bill like the back of your hand and be able to offer suggestions on how best to optimize it.
-
Database & Data Infrastructure Support: Partner with engineering to manage and scale data infrastructure (e.g., Postgres, DynamoDB, Pipelines), including backups, disaster recovery, and performance tuning.
-
Developer Experience: Build tooling and self-service workflows that make it easy for engineers to deploy, test, and debug their services, reducing friction across the development lifecycle.
-
Collaboration & Product Thinking: Work cross-functionally with software and ML engineers, product leads, and domain experts to translate scaling and reliability needs into concrete infrastructure investments.
